Last week a video created by men’s rights activists (MRAs) began circulating on the internet. Supposedly entitled The Last Jedi: De-Feminized Fanedit, the movie was Star Wars VIII: The Last Jedi, minus all scenes featuring a female performer.

The anonymous creator described it as:

…basically The Last Jedi minus Girlz Powah and other silly stuff.

The edit was obviously an incredibly sexist gesture, and the team behind The Last Jedi openly mocked it on Twitter:

Fortunately, Twitter user @LoganJames had the perfect response. Knowing tit for tat was fair play, he released a version of Saving Private Ryan with all the men edited out.

The video fit easily into a Twitter post, since, without any men, the movie is only two and a half minutes long.

Ryan’s edit quickly went viral, so he followed up with a male-free version of another classic: The Shawshank Redemption:
